Jammu Tawi Flood Live: Flash floods in the river Jammu Tawi have left one person trapped, quick response from the State Disaster Response Force (SDRF) saved his life. The trapped individual was successfully rescued by the SDRF team. Teams are working tirelessly in critical situations.
11 labourers trapped in Ujh River flood rescued by SDRF, police in Kathua.
The National Disaster Response Force (NDRF) and SDRF have been put on high alert as flash floods continue to wreak havoc in different parts of Jammu. The weather department has issued a warning for heavy rainfall, further exacerbating the situation. A dumper was submerged in water due to the flash floods, highlighting the severity of the flooding.

NDRF teams have been strategically positioned on the banks of the Jammu Tawi river to respond promptly to any emergencies. The NDRF has deployed its men and machinery to the ground for rescue operations, ensuring that they are prepared for any eventuality. NDRF officials have assured that they will remain on standby until the water levels recede, emphasizing their commitment to safeguarding lives and property.
The situation remains critical, and authorities are urging residents to stay vigilant and follow safety guidelines. The combined efforts of the SDRF and NDRF are crucial in managing the ongoing crisis and mitigating the impact of the flash floods.
